613 Plus VAT
VAT Added Gross amount = Initial Price x (1 + VAT percentage)
Simply:- £735.60 = £613 x (1 + 20%) or £613 x (1 + 20/100)
Let me tell you another way to calculate £735.60
For example: Let’s say a product costs £613 before VAT.
- £613 (product cost) x 20% (VAT rate) = £122.60
- So the total price with VAT is: £613 (product cost) + £122.60 (VAT) = £735.60
